Home Value Estimator For Denver, IN

There are currently 682 real estate properties in Denver, IN, with a median automated valuation model (AVM) price of $200,928.00. What is an AVM? It is a smart computer program that analyzes and predicts the approximate value of a home, property or land in Denver, IN, based on current market trends, comparable real estate sales nearby, historical data and, of course, property features, among other variables. These automated home estimates are often very helpful, providing buyers and sellers with a better idea of a home’s value ahead of the negotiation process.
